From 0f4f0d5860e4a261f37ae6f294c154c3009c4562 Mon Sep 17 00:00:00 2001 From: Arno Date: Fri, 5 Apr 2013 17:01:57 +0200 Subject: Make FilesystemWidget headers configurable Save headerView on exit, create a Menu for selecting headers and read headerConfig on startup. --- filesystemwidget.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'filesystemwidget.cpp') diff --git a/filesystemwidget.cpp b/filesystemwidget.cpp index 28822fd..64dfd1c 100644 --- a/filesystemwidget.cpp +++ b/filesystemwidget.cpp @@ -75,7 +75,6 @@ FilesystemWidget::FilesystemWidget(QWidget *parent) : QWidget(parent), mClipboar mFileView->setSelectionBehavior(QAbstractItemView::SelectRows); mFileView->setAlternatingRowColors(true); - mFileView->setColumnHidden(static_cast(SmDirModel::FullPath), true); mFileProxy->setDynamicSortFilter(true); connect(mFileView->selectionModel(), SIGNAL(selectionChanged(QItemSelection,QItemSelection)), mFileView, SLOT(selectedFilesChanged())); connect(mFileModel, SIGNAL(modelAboutToBeReset()), mFileView, SLOT(saveSelection())); @@ -340,6 +339,7 @@ void FilesystemWidget::readSettings(){ } QPoint picViewerPos = s.value("windows/picviewer").toPoint(); mPicViewer->move(picViewerPos); + mFileView->readConfig(); } void FilesystemWidget::writeSettings(){ @@ -352,6 +352,7 @@ void FilesystemWidget::writeSettings(){ s.setValue("paths/selecteddir", dir); } s.setValue("windows/picviewer", mPicViewer->pos()); + mFileView->writeConfig(); } void FilesystemWidget::configChanged(){ -- cgit v1.2.3-70-g09d2